Frequently asked questions on first aid supplies and training

We’ve collected some answers to common questions that can help you decide what needs to be done to improve safety in the workplace or household.

Q: Should I complete a first aid risk assessment?

A: Yes! First aid requirements vary from one workplace or home to another. It’s important to consider the potential risks and hazards to decide what arrangements you need to have in place.

Q: Do I need to have a first aid officer?

A: You need to make sure that everyone has access to an adequate number of trained first aiders. The person should have first aid training or be willing to take a first aid training course.

Q: How many first aiders do I need?

A: Depending on the risk assessment, it can be anywhere from one first aid officer for every 50 workers or one for every 25.
